The Yotsuya Kaidan is one of the three great ghost stories of Japan. The story is often truncated in English without the full horror of Oiwa's story and and betrayal that turned her into a vengeful ghost. Listen to her sad and terrifying tale three hundred years in the making.

Japan has a history of lake monsters inhabiting its lakes. Like the Lock Ness Monster, some appear to be surviving plesiosaurs, while others may be something entirely different. In this episode, we take a look at the stories behind Issie, Mossie, Hama-chan, and other lake cryptids of Japan.

This episode tells the story of the Ikiningyo, or Living Doll. Generally considered the most horrific of documented doll possessions in modern Japanese history, this tale is part one of the experience of comedian Inagawa, whose horrific experiences with this doll span over two decades. Though perhaps the most well known haunted doll story in Japan, Inagawa's story has never been fully brought to an English speaking audience until now. Taken from his writings and interviews, and from the studio and audience witnesses, this tale rivals anything spawned by the most demented Hollywood scriptwriters.

Every nation has tales of haunted or cursed dolls. Japan is no exception. This episode explores stories of an urban legend of Licca-chan dolls, Okiku the haunted doll, and Wara-Ningyo, the straw dolls used for curses.

Three urban legends in Japan strike fear into the hearts of middle and high schoolers. Hear these legends and their mysterious origins: Teke Teke, The Slit-Faced woman, and Kashima-san.
